DOX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2023 in Review

455 of the 6,275 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Amdocs (DOX) for Q1 2023, worth a combined $11B — up 8.9% from $10.1B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 45 funds opened new DOX positions and 40 closed out — a net gain of 5 holders — while 144 added to existing stakes and 197 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Fidelity Investments, adding an estimated $161M. The largest seller was Schroder Investment Management Group, cutting an estimated $57.8M.
